<Blue Door Guesthouse> is about 25-30 minutes on foot from Nagoya Station and about 10 minutes on foot from Nagoya Municipal Subway "Taikodori Station." Since I walked to this guesthouse, I thought it might be a bit far, but it wasn't that far later.
On the day of check-in at the guesthouse, a message from the staff will arrive, so check the message carefully and check in yourself when you arrive at the accommodation for convenient use. The staff usually works from 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M (sometimes they are absent), and you can also contact the cleaning staff in the morning.
Although it was spring, the weather was still a little chilly, so I was able to sleep comfortably thanks to the comfortable mattress, pillow that supported my head well, and warm blanket. You can use a personal locker during your stay, and you can eat in the shared kitchen and common area on the first floor and chat with fellow travelers.
The internet speed was also pretty good, so I was able to work on the computer in the morning without any problems.
There was a nice space on the rooftop of the guesthouse, and I could see a nice view as the sun set. There was also a shower, a toilet, and a bathtub, which was helpful for relieving fatigue.
I recommend bringing your own towels. However, you can rent them at the guesthouse, and you can also use the washing machine.
The area around the guesthouse is very quiet and is a residential area for locals, so it wasn't too noisy at night. There were many restaurants around the accommodation, including Korean, *********, and Italian cuisine, and a tea house that served toast and coffee where you can experience Nagoya's "Kissaten" culture. There was a 7-Eleven a 2-minute walk away, and a large supermarket a little further away, so it was very convenient to buy groceries, lunch boxes, ramen, etc.
